Transaction 68145851bc17a73e1fde5af410e189eeb20c2c325a655a4b2dd9c91428967970

2 Input
2 Outputs
  • 68145851bc17a73e1fde5af410e189eeb20c2c325a655a4b2dd9c91428967970:0
  • value  20000000
    address  1JiixnNK52kMtxMRuC26YMsyCxoBZzkinw
  • 68145851bc17a73e1fde5af410e189eeb20c2c325a655a4b2dd9c91428967970:1
  • value  3751330
    address  1KXGqFqCpAvXK9jaK1C4QPTQYszPPXChbH